When Prince Harry is expected in London next week, his brother Prince William and his wife Princess Kate will already be several hundred kilometers away. The couple will be traveling to Scotland starting Tuesday, where official appointments in Stirling are on their agenda. A personal meeting, thus, seems once again off the table.
Harry is not traveling for private reasons, but for an important court date. He is to testify again in a civil lawsuit against the publisher Associated Newspapers, which publishes the "Daily Mail" among others. The accusation: unlawful information gathering. Co-plaintiffs include prominent names like Elton John and Liz Hurley.
